    The Benefits of a Mesothelioma Legal Action

    A successful lawsuit will help victims and their families to be financially secure for the future. It can also ensure that asbestos companies are held accountable for putting profits over safety.

    Lawsuits typically begin by filing a complaint in a court. The complaint describes the victim's exposure to danger and the reason why compensation is due. The defendant company has 30 days to respond. Nearly all mesothelioma lawsuits end in settlements, rather than going to court.

    Compensation

    The purpose of mesothelioma compensation is to help victims and their families gain financial stability, pay their medical expenses and provide for themselves in the future. It also serves as justice by holding asbestos companies that are negligent accountable for their actions.

    The types of mesothelioma settlements that are available to patients may differ however the median amount is $1 million. Compensation can be monetary or for lost income as well as suffering and pain funeral expenses and other loss of amenities.

    Compensation may also be derived from private insurance programs, government programs including veterans benefits, trust funds. A mesothelioma lawyer can identify the most beneficial sources for their client. They can also file claims for asbestos victims in the courts that are most willing to hear their case. Factors such as the history of asbestos litigation in a court and state statutes of limitations can impact this decision.

    Mesothelioma patients who are enrolled in Medicare or other health insurance can apply for supplemental mesothelioma benefits. Medicare beneficiaries with mesothelioma settlement may be eligible for additional coverage under the Comprehensive Care for Asbestos Patients program (CCAP). Social Security Disability Insurance (SSDI) is also available to mesothelioma patients who qualify. This form of financial assistance is available to people who meet the requirements for work eligibility and who pay Social Security taxes.

    Families of mesothelioma patients who have passed away may file wrongful death lawsuits. The survivors of the victim may be entitled to compensation for funeral expenses funeral expenses, burial costs, loss of companionship, financial support, and other losses.

    Most mesothelioma lawsuits are settled out of court, which allows victims and their families to receive their compensation quicker. If a settlement is not reached, mesothelioma law attorneys can take the case to court.

    It is important to seek legal advice as soon as possible. The earlier the claims process begins, the longer attorneys have to collect evidence and speak with witnesses. This is particularly relevant when someone close to you has passed away from mesothelioma or any other asbestos-related illness. The law firm that handles a mesothelioma lawsuit can start the claim process on behalf of a surviving spouse, child or parent.

    Medical expenses

    Medical expenses are an important consideration for mesothelioma victims and their families. Compensation can cover the cost of expensive treatments, assist with lost income due to illness, and provide for the needs of families, such as childcare. Compensation can also help defray the emotional stress that comes with financial difficulties.

    Compensation is available through many sources such as settlements for personal injury, or lawsuits for wrongful deaths and asbestos trust funds. Compensation amounts differ for each mesothelioma lawsuit (internet site) and are based on the severity of the symptoms and the type of cancer, as well as treatment plan. Mesothelioma lawyers consider every aspect of the victim's case in order to maximize the amount of compensation.

    To prepare for legal proceedings, patients and their families must keep meticulous records of every expense related to mesothelioma. The more documentation available, the greater likelihood of an outcome in the form of a mesothelioma lawsuit or verdict. These records are also useful for attorneys during settlement negotiations.

    Mesothelioma is a rare and aggressive cancer that requires costly treatments. The cost of treatment can mount up quickly, particularly if patients have to travel for treatment. Compensation may cover travel and accommodation expenses for mesothelioma sufferers and their families.

    A mesothelioma lawyer can aid clients in understanding and access government programs, as well as other resources available to help with medical expenses associated with mesothelioma law. These may include patient assistance programs, charity resources and clinical trials of new therapies.

    While no amount will compensate the cost of being diagnosed with mesothelioma, a successful mesothelioma lawsuit can aid the affected person and their family members. An experienced mesothelioma lawyer is the best choice for individuals seeking compensation. They specialize in asbestos litigation and will build a strong case that will result in the highest amount of settlement.     Suffering and pain

    A successful mesothelioma case will provide the money victims need to pay for medical expenses and other expenses. Compensation can also help a family member maintain a good quality of life during this difficult time.

    A mesothelioma suit is a means of holding negligent asbestos product manufacturers accountable for their actions. It is a form of justice for families who have lost their loved ones due to corporate negligence. The money won't bring back a loved-one but it will keep a family financially secure and stable for years.

    The award could also cover other costs including loss of income, property damage, and funeral expenses. A mesothelioma lawyer who is experienced can determine the best approach for a case, based on the specific circumstances of the victim.

    As soon as the diagnosis is confirmed patients should seek out a mesothelioma lawyer. It is essential to file a claim before the time limit for filing claims expires. It is crucial to make a claim prior to the statute of limitations runs out.

    Many patients are hesitant to pursue a mesothelioma lawsuit because they do not want to be perceived as greedy. Fortunately, filing a lawsuit isn't about getting a big payout. It's about stopping the reckless behavior of corporations that put profits before people's lives.

    Loss of Income

    The expenses of mesothelioma can increase quickly. The cost of missed work in the past as well as ongoing treatment for mesothelioma, and other requirements that are commonplace make it difficult to pay for financial obligations. Compensation can help you recuperate these expenses.

    Although no amount will ever be able to completely compensate a person suffering from mesothelioma's affliction however, a settlement can help pay their medical bills and maintain an adequate financial foundation for their family. A successful lawsuit can also send a strong signal to negligent asbestos companies that corporate greed will not be tolerated.

    A qualified mesothelioma attorney can help determine the best approach to get victims compensation that covers all of their losses and assists them to build a more secure financial future. The lawyer will also fight for full amount of compensation allowed by the law.

    Compensation for mesothelioma is obtained through a variety of legal claims. These include trust funds, personal injury and wrongful deaths lawsuits. A mesothelioma lawsuit is filed by an individual suffering from the disease or a loved one on their behalf against those responsible for their exposure asbestos. The statute of limitations is a period of time that the law imposes on plaintiffs to file a suit.

    A mesothelioma lawyer will examine the unique facts of a patient's situation and determine the legal options available. The majority of clients settle their cases instead of having to go to trial as trials can take longer and risky.

    A diagnosis of mesothelioma should be a trigger for a person seeking out a mesothelioma attorney immediately to start the legal process. Due to the slender time limits patients must act fast. A mesothelioma attorney will be able to explain the laws of their state and ensure that the patient files their claim before the deadline passes. The lawyer will prepare and file the suit on behalf of the client, and take care of every step of the procedure. A mesothelioma attorney can help veterans file VA benefits claims for mesothelioma as well as assist with any potential legal action against the US government. The lawyer will help the patient get all the documentation necessary to complete the VA claim and mesothelioma lawsuit.
